Output 063a2cd24f6e327c1435eff7c6661b88eb0d8e9ea7c7cf15bdb2665dcfb71df7:177

value
198907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 008859cc0e48c31e0aea500034204c90bbc9d899 OP_EQUAL
address
31jqGMun7NBKY8kCHh2XRUCVagYQjzAz3E
transaction
063a2cd24f6e327c1435eff7c6661b88eb0d8e9ea7c7cf15bdb2665dcfb71df7
spent
true